Paper Pallet Market Size
The Global Paper Pallet Market Size reached USD 699.72 Million in 2025 and is projected to increase to USD 713.71 Million in 2026, USD 727.99 Million in 2027, and further expand to USD 852.95 Million by 2035, reflecting a steady 2% growth rate during the forecast period. The market advancement is driven by rising sustainability compliance, with nearly 68% of industries shifting to recyclable pallet formats and more than 54% reducing dependence on traditional wood pallets. Approximately 47% of exporters adopt paper pallets for improved global shipment efficiency, reinforcing consistent market expansion.

Paper Pallet Market Trends
The Paper Pallet Market is undergoing structural transformation driven by sustainability mandates, rapid industrial packaging shifts, and accelerated logistics optimization. Demand for eco-friendly pallet alternatives is growing as nearly 68% of manufacturing firms now prioritize recyclable load carriers. Lightweight paper pallets are gaining traction, with adoption rates increasing by more than 42% across FMCG and retail distribution networks due to reduced handling costs. Close to 55% of exporters prefer fiber-based pallets to eliminate fumigation requirements. In automated warehouses, usage penetration has crossed 47% owing to uniform dimensions and ease of robotic handling.
Corrugated paper pallets currently account for around 52% of material preference, while honeycomb designs hold nearly 31% share due to superior compression strength. Over 60% of e-commerce fulfillment centers report shifting toward paper pallets to meet green-logistics targets. Sustainability-driven procurement policies influence almost 70% of pallet purchasing decisions globally, with recyclability and weight reduction being the top selection metrics. Approximately 58% of logistics companies claim paper pallets help cut load weight by double-digit percentages, reducing fuel consumption across regional transport routes. As circular economy adoption accelerates, usage concentration of renewable-material pallets is projected to surpass current penetration by significant percentage margins, reinforcing paper pallets’ dominance in green packaging ecosystems.

RESTRAINTS
"Load-Bearing Limitations in Heavy-Duty Applications"
Adoption is restrained as nearly 43% of industrial users indicate paper pallets underperform under high-weight loads. Close to 39% of manufacturers cite compromised durability in humid or moisture-exposed environments. Roughly 41% of logistics managers face challenges using paper pallets for heavy machinery, chemicals, and metal components. Approximately 36% prefer traditional wooden pallets for their higher structural strength, reducing penetration in heavy-load and long-haul transportation sectors.
CHALLENGE
"Fluctuating Fiber Raw Material Availability"
Market expansion faces challenges as nearly 47% of pallet producers experience raw-material availability fluctuations that impact production stability. Around 38% of manufacturers encounter double-digit increases in fiberboard input costs during supply tightness. Close to 35% report inconsistencies in compression strength due to variable fiber quality grades. Approximately 33% of supply chain planners highlight scaling difficulties when raw-material volatility disrupts procurement cycles, delaying production capacity optimization and global supply commitments.

By Type
Corrugated Pallet
Corrugated pallets dominate the category, with nearly 52% penetration among industries focused on lightweight and recyclable logistics solutions. Their usage is supported by 48% higher handling efficiency and almost 44% preference among exporters due to fumigation-free compliance. Approximately 56% of e-commerce warehouses utilize corrugated formats for optimized automation compatibility.
Corrugated Pallet Market Size: The segment held a leading share in 2025, accounting for a significant portion of the global market. It represented a substantial percentage share and is expected to grow at a CAGR of 2% through 2035, propelled by lightweight mobility, recyclability, and higher acceptance across retail and export supply chains.
Honeycomb Pallet
Honeycomb pallets maintain around 31% share due to their high compression strength and nearly 46% stronger load distribution capability than other paper-based structures. Approximately 41% of manufacturing units engaged in medium-load shipments prefer honeycomb pallets, while 39% of logistics centers report reduced damage incidents using this format.
Honeycomb Pallet Market Size: This segment contributed a significant proportional share in 2025, supported by rising demand for high-strength sustainable materials. It is projected to expand steadily with a 2% CAGR, reinforced by structural performance advantages across industrial packaging environments.
Other Paper Pallet Types
The remaining category, including molded fiber and mixed-composite paper pallets, accounts for nearly 17% of the market. Adoption rises as 36% of SMEs seek low-cost, customizable pallet designs. Approximately 34% of small distributors value these pallets for low-volume transport, while 28% of warehousing facilities integrate them into short-route delivery systems.
Other Types Market Size: The segment held a modest but stable share in 2025, contributing a meaningful portion of total demand. With user preference for economical formats increasing, this segment maintains a 2% CAGR through 2035, driven by flexible design capabilities and affordability.

Paper Pallet Market Regional Outlook
The Paper Pallet Market shows balanced global penetration with clear regional growth dynamics shaped by sustainability adoption, supply chain modernization, and industrial packaging transitions. With the market valued at USD 699.72 Million in 2025 and projected to reach USD 852.95 Million by 2035 at a 2% CAGR, regional shares distribute across North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, and Middle East & Africa. North America leads with robust automation uptake, Europe follows with stringent eco-regulations, Asia-Pacific exhibits the fastest structural expansion, and the Middle East & Africa gradually accelerates with logistics infrastructure upgrades. Collectively, regional segmentation allocates 100% distribution across global demand clusters.
North America
North America holds strong market traction with rising adoption of recyclable pallet systems across automated warehouses, retail logistics, and export packaging operations. Nearly 63% of regional warehouses prefer lightweight paper pallets for operational ease, while about 58% of U.S. and Canadian exporters rely on paper formats for compliance-friendly shipping. Around 49% of automated logistics hubs report improved throughput using standardized paper pallet systems. E-commerce penetration and sustainability-driven procurement further reinforce regional demand.
North America Market Size, Share, and Growth: North America accounted for USD 196.92 Million in 2025, representing 28% of the global market. The region continues to expand steadily through 2035, supported by automation, environmental policies, and rising freight optimization needs.
Europe
Europe maintains robust adoption driven by strong regulation toward recyclable materials and circular economy mandates. Nearly 67% of manufacturers emphasize fiber-based pallet integration to meet compliance requirements, while around 52% of exporters transition to paper pallets to avoid chemical treatment protocols. Approximately 48% of large retailers in Germany, France, and Italy use paper pallets to reduce environmental footprint. Logistic hubs increasingly integrate sustainable pallet systems to optimize carbon output and operational flow.
Europe Market Size, Share, and Growth: Europe accounted for USD 181.92 Million in 2025, representing 26% of the global market. Continued growth through 2035 is supported by eco-regulations, automated warehouse expansion, and rising demand for recyclable industrial packaging.
Asia-Pacific
Asia-Pacific demonstrates the highest structural expansion, driven by manufacturing output, export intensity, and rapidly modernizing logistics networks. Approximately 59% of industrial exporters in China, Japan, and South Korea prefer paper pallets for reduced freight weight. Nearly 62% of e-commerce fulfillment centers integrate paper pallets to improve throughput, while around 47% of SMEs adopt cost-efficient pallet alternatives. Sustainability restructuring among emerging economies enhances long-term market penetration.
Asia-Pacific Market Size, Share, and Growth: Asia-Pacific accounted for USD 237.90 Million in 2025, representing 34% of the global market. The region shows the strongest expansion trajectory through 2035, supported by high-volume manufacturing and heavy logistics digitalization.
Middle East & Africa
Middle East & Africa shows consistent development supported by logistics modernization, retail expansion, and diversification into export-driven industries. Nearly 44% of distributors favor lightweight pallets for reduced transport costs, while around 38% of storage facilities adopt paper pallets for improved handling. Approximately 33% of export-oriented firms shift to recyclable pallet alternatives to enhance compliance compatibility across global trade lanes.
Middle East & Africa Market Size, Share, and Growth: Middle East & Africa accounted for USD 84.00 Million in 2025, representing 12% of the global market. The region expands gradually through 2035 due to increasing warehousing investments, strengthened trade networks, and rising demand for sustainable packaging formats.
